About the Role  

The Communications Specialist role is responsible for assisting in the development of strategic communication initiatives and stakeholder messaging at the Australian Museum. In this role you will be focusing on delivering high-impact communication projects, including assisting with the development of the annual report as well as key internal communications channels. The Communications Specialist will provide effective internal and external communications and engagement and assist with communications project management.

You will be paid a competitive annual salary $99,938 – $110,271 plus employer’s contribution to superannuation (currently 12%) and annual leave loading.

About you 

We are seeking a communications professional who has a proven track record of developing and executing internal and external communication initiatives within a complex or multifaceted organisation. You will have well-developed interpersonal skills and can adapt your communication approach to engage a diverse range of stakeholders. You enjoy working independently and collaboratively while successfully managing competing priorities and deliverables.
